Welcome to Hawkins, Indiana -- where Stranger Things are happening. The hit show has now been immortalized in brick form in the first Netflix-themed Lego set, which has the unusual feature of being able to flip over and stand either way up. One side is the Byers house from the show, and the other is a dark mirror image -- the creepy parallel dimension known as the Upside Down. Let's take a closer look...

The set is designed to be built by two people, with two sets of instructions so you can work side by side.
Stranger Things Lego
The set includes 2,287 bricks and is designed to be built by two people, who get half of the set each.

One of you builds the regular house, and your friend builds its mirror image, the Upside Down version.

When you're done, the two halves of the set clip securely together.
Stranger Things Lego
Sheriff Hopper shows up in his Chevrolet Blazer police cruiser. You can drive it around separately, or fix it in place so it stays parked even when you flip the set upside down.

Look at the detail on the drawing Joyce holds. The set is full of such nifty detail, including missing persons flyers and posters on the wall.
Stranger Things Lego
The living room boasts an alphabet wall of fairy lights that Joyce used to communicate with her missing son -- and it really lights up thanks to a light brick mounted in the ceiling.

The various rooms of the house are mirrored in the Upside Down, with a creepy twist.
Stranger Things Lego
The Upside Down house is made of gray and blue bricks, with sinister tendrils and tentacles everywhere.

Luckily, Will's friends are on their way! Dustin, Lucas, Eleven and Mike come with signature headwear and accessories including a catapult, compass and tasty Eggo waffles.

The full Stranger Things Lego minifig line-up: the demogorgon, Eleven, Will, Joyce, Hopper, Dustin, Lucas and Mike.

The set is supported by sturdy legs on either side, disguised as trees, so you can easily flip it over without it coming to pieces. It also comes with a display stand for your minifigs. Grab a friend and pick up the Lego Stranger Things set, or wait for season 3 to start on July 4.
